About this hospice
Caringedge Hospice Hermantown is a for-profit hospice agency based in Hermantown, Minnesota, serving families in St. Louis County. According to CMS Care Compare data, this hospice has been Medicare-certified since July 3, 2019.
CMS has not published a CAHPS overall star rating for this hospice, which often happens when the number of surveyed families is too small to report reliably; this is not an indication of poor quality. In the CAHPS family caregiver survey, 81% of respondents said they would definitely recommend this hospice, and 79% gave it an overall rating of 9 or 10 on a 10-point scale.
On CMS's composite process measure, which reflects how consistently core hospice care processes were delivered, Caringedge Hospice Hermantown scored 91.30, compared with a Minnesota state average of 97.62 — placing it below the state average on this measure. CMS also reports that visits occurred in the last days of life for 79.1% of patients, and a care index score of 9.
The hospice's service area, as reported to CMS, covers 23 ZIP codes from its Hermantown office.

What is the difference between hospice and palliative care?
Palliative care can be provided at any stage of a serious illness alongside curative treatment, while hospice care focuses on comfort for those with a life-limiting illness who have generally stopped curative treatment.
Does choosing hospice mean giving up treatment?
No — hospice shifts the focus to comfort and quality of life rather than curing an illness, but it does not mean giving up care or support.
